We're looking for a confident and driven Analyst to join us on a 6-month basis to support with a key project. Utilising your excellent Excel skills, you'll work closely with our Commercial Finance and Buying teams to support with data analysis and auditing.
Responsibilities
- Collaborate closely with Commercial Finance teams and Buying teams to:
- Analyse and validate supplier funding arrangements
- Review and audit supporting documentation for accuracy and completeness
- Maintain and manage SharePoint repositories, ensuring data is accurate, organised, and up to date
- Provide support across finance and buying functions through effective stakeholder engagement
- Assist in identifying discrepancies, improving processes, and ensuring compliance with internal controls
The Ideal Candidate
- Advanced Excel skills (essential), including data analysis and reconciliation
- Excellent interpersonal and communication skills, with the ability to work effectively across multiple teams (buyers, assistants, finance teams)
- Desirable: Exposure to or experience in project management
